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
590838057 19912093125 08481047567 49660
35904810862 411931 50833351
35904810862 411931 50833351
845998 024796 12
All about undefined
Interested in learning more?
35904810862 411931 50833351
845998 024796 12
See more
9866125 51883303
6698983 449 19
See more
3448 649473759
3103982267 65 68482411 966 624
See more